Plan Commission approves ADU, warehouse use amendment, CSM amendment and 8‑ft fence

Plan Commission of the City of Franklin · February 20, 2026

Summary

After the TID 10 hearing, the commission unanimously recommended an ADU conditional‑use permit at 8866 W. Pewds (with conditions), approved a special‑use amendment to allow warehouse/distribution in PDL 39 at 3617 W. Oakwood Road, recommended a 2‑lot certified survey map amendment for Northwestern Mutual/Drexel, and approved an 8‑foot fence permit at 8861 S. 27th Street.

Following the TID 10 public hearing, the Franklin Plan Commission considered and approved several separate land‑use items.
